Inspection is complete at Michigan.
No issues for Buescher. He is officially the winner.
The #5 and 23 will return to the R&D Center for inspection.
The #5, 99, 22, 23 will return to the R&D Center for engine dyno.
The #7 and 16 will return to Concord, NC for the wind tunnel.
